Coping With Separation Anxiety in Relationships. What Is a Rebound Relationship? Ever had a crush on a celebrity who had no idea you existed? Lingering feelings for an ex after breaking up? Or maybe you fell deeply in love with a close friend but kept your feelings secret. But the pain of one-sided love can linger when you truly love someone.

Unfortunately, this is a pretty universal experience. Unrequited love can look different across different scenarios. You want to explore a deeper connection, so you start inviting them to spend more time together. But they keep their distance as you try to get closer. Their lack of interest can also show up in your emotional connection.

When you try asking questions about their beliefs and values, for example, they may not offer much in their answers nor ask you similar questions in return. Maybe they take forever reply to messages.

No matter how you dice it, unrequited love hurts. You might find yourself thinking of ways to make yourself more attractive to the other person. Maybe snowboarding is their favorite hobby, so you suddenly take it up — despite hating both the cold and sports.

Your feelings for the person might come up throughout your day, in different areas of your life. In fact, a small study from suggests rejection activates the same areas in the brain as physical pain. These tips can help you cope with the pain until it lessens. Feel too overwhelming? Falling in love is supposed to be the most amazing feeling you experience in your entire life. Rejection can leave an empty hole in your heart. Perhaps they are in a different place in their life.

Perhaps they just got out of a long-term relationship. Who knows? Accepting the reality of the situation is tough, but it is the most important step towards dealing with your hurting heart. Forgive the other person and start the healing process by letting go of the disappointment that is weighing on your heart.

Sometimes we have a hard time coming to terms with unrequited love. We may think that if we do something different or change our approach, it might work out. The best thing you can do for yourself is to put some distance between you and your crush. The hope you feel is only an illusion. What you need is time to grieve the loss. Cut off all communication. It is time to move on, and moving on will be a lot easier to do with a healthy distance between you. Give yourself a day or two to vent and cry.

Now is a great time to rethink your future. Throw yourself into something new. If you can distract yourself while also doing something valuable for your life, it is a win-win. Since that ship has sailed, it is time for a redesign. What do you want to get out of life?

What can you do now to advance your career or your education? What about a new hobby? Not only will planning help take the focus off the painful experience, but you can also turn those hurtful feelings into feelings of excitement for what the future holds. Examples of unrequited love:. Falling in love with someone who doesn't feel the same way Developing romantic feelings for a friend who only sees you as a friend Wanting to be with someone who's already in another relationship Wanting to be with someone you can't be with for some reason e.

Wanting to get back together with an ex who has moved on Developing strong romantic feelings for a famous person or celebrity. Signs of unrequited love. They're actively maintaining distance from you. They make themselves romantically available for others but not for you.

Your efforts feel unbalanced in the relationship. Is unrequited love really love? What causes unrequited love?
